    Specify initial output of a 3-way text merge

    I can specify the output filename when I perform a 3-way text merge, but the initial text in the output pane is always the auto-merged result produced by BC. Is there a way to use the contents of my output file as the initial text in the output pane?

    In my case, I have an external tool that produces its "best guess" at a merge result. I'd like to use BC to display my output alongside the 3 inputs so that I can manually verify (and tweak) the results.

    It isn't possible to use a file as input for the output pane of the Text Merge. Output will always be filled with BC's auto-merge result.
